ICD-10: E73.8

Other lactose intolerance

Additional Information

Description

Lactose intolerance is a common condition characterized by the inability to properly digest lactose, a sugar found in milk and dairy products. The ICD-10 code E73.8 specifically refers to "Other lactose intolerance," which encompasses various forms of lactose intolerance that do not fall under the more commonly recognized categories.

Clinical Description of E73.8: Other Lactose Intolerance

Definition

E73.8 is used to classify lactose intolerance that is not specified as primary or secondary. Primary lactose intolerance is typically genetic and results from a decrease in lactase enzyme production after weaning, while secondary lactose intolerance can occur due to other medical conditions affecting the intestines, such as infections or inflammatory diseases.

Symptoms

Individuals with lactose intolerance may experience a range of gastrointestinal symptoms after consuming lactose-containing foods. Common symptoms include:

  • Bloating: A feeling of fullness or swelling in the abdomen.
  • Diarrhea: Loose or watery stools, often occurring shortly after lactose ingestion.
  • Gas: Increased flatulence due to fermentation of undigested lactose in the colon.
  • Abdominal Pain: Cramping or discomfort in the stomach area.

These symptoms can vary in severity depending on the amount of lactose consumed and the individual's level of lactase deficiency.

Diagnosis

Diagnosis of lactose intolerance typically involves a combination of patient history, symptom assessment, and specific tests. Common diagnostic methods include:

  • Lactose Tolerance Test: Measures the body's response to a standard dose of lactose.
  • Hydrogen Breath Test: Measures the amount of hydrogen in the breath after consuming lactose, as undigested lactose ferments in the colon, producing hydrogen.
  • Stool Acidity Test: Particularly useful in children, this test checks for lactic acid in the stool, indicating lactose malabsorption.

Management

Management of E73.8 involves dietary modifications and symptom management. Key strategies include:

  • Lactose-Free Diet: Avoiding foods high in lactose, such as milk, cheese, and ice cream.
  • Lactase Supplements: Over-the-counter lactase enzyme supplements can help individuals digest lactose more effectively when consuming dairy products.
  • Alternative Dairy Products: Utilizing lactose-free milk and dairy alternatives, such as almond or soy milk, can provide similar nutritional benefits without the discomfort.

Prognosis

The prognosis for individuals diagnosed with E73.8 is generally positive, as most can manage their symptoms effectively through dietary changes and lifestyle adjustments. However, the condition can significantly impact quality of life if not properly managed, leading to nutritional deficiencies if dairy products are eliminated without suitable alternatives.

Clinical Presentation

Definition and Types

Lactose intolerance occurs when the body lacks sufficient levels of lactase, the enzyme responsible for breaking down lactose into glucose and galactose for absorption. While primary lactose intolerance is the most prevalent form, secondary lactose intolerance can arise due to gastrointestinal diseases, infections, or other conditions affecting the intestinal lining. E73.8 includes cases that may not be classified under primary or secondary lactose intolerance, such as congenital lactase deficiency or lactose malabsorption due to other underlying conditions.

Signs and Symptoms

Patients with E73.8 may exhibit a range of gastrointestinal symptoms following the consumption of lactose-containing foods. Common signs and symptoms include:

  • Bloating: A feeling of fullness or swelling in the abdomen, often due to gas production from undigested lactose.
  • Diarrhea: Watery stools that may occur shortly after lactose ingestion, resulting from the osmotic effect of unabsorbed lactose in the intestines.
  • Abdominal Pain: Cramping or discomfort in the abdominal area, which can vary in intensity.
  • Flatulence: Increased gas production leading to excessive passing of gas.
  • Nausea: A feeling of sickness that may accompany other gastrointestinal symptoms.

These symptoms typically manifest within 30 minutes to two hours after consuming lactose-containing foods or beverages.

Patient Characteristics

Demographics

Lactose intolerance can affect individuals of all ages, but certain demographic factors may influence its prevalence:

  • Age: Symptoms often develop in late childhood or adulthood, as lactase production typically decreases after weaning.
  • Ethnicity: Lactose intolerance is more common in certain populations, particularly among individuals of East Asian, West African, Arab, Jewish, Greek, and Italian descent. In contrast, those of Northern European descent tend to have higher rates of lactase persistence.

Risk Factors

Several factors may increase the likelihood of developing lactose intolerance, including:

  • Family History: A genetic predisposition can play a significant role, as lactose intolerance often runs in families.
  • Gastrointestinal Conditions: Conditions such as celiac disease, Crohn's disease, or gastroenteritis can damage the intestinal lining and lead to secondary lactose intolerance.
  • Infections: Acute gastrointestinal infections can temporarily reduce lactase production, resulting in transient lactose intolerance.

Diagnosis

Diagnosis of lactose intolerance typically involves a combination of patient history, symptom assessment, and diagnostic tests. Common methods include:

  • Lactose Tolerance Test: Measures the body's response to a lactose load, assessing blood glucose levels.
  • Hydrogen Breath Test: Measures hydrogen levels in the breath after lactose ingestion, indicating malabsorption.
  • Elimination Diet: Involves removing lactose from the diet and monitoring symptom resolution.

Treatment Guidelines

Lactose intolerance, classified under ICD-10 code E73.8 as "Other lactose intolerance," refers to the inability to digest lactose, a sugar found in milk and dairy products. This condition can lead to various gastrointestinal symptoms, including bloating, diarrhea, and abdominal pain, following the consumption of lactose-containing foods. The management of lactose intolerance typically involves dietary modifications and, in some cases, pharmacological interventions. Below is a detailed overview of standard treatment approaches for this condition.

Dietary Management

1. Lactose-Free Diet

The cornerstone of managing lactose intolerance is adopting a lactose-free diet. This involves eliminating or significantly reducing the intake of foods that contain lactose, such as:

  • Dairy Products: Milk, cheese, yogurt, and ice cream are primary sources of lactose. Individuals may need to choose lactose-free alternatives, which are widely available in supermarkets.
  • Processed Foods: Many processed foods may contain lactose as an ingredient, so reading labels is essential.

2. Lactose-Reduced Products

For some individuals, consuming lactose-reduced dairy products can be a viable option. These products have been treated to remove or break down lactose, making them easier to digest.

3. Gradual Introduction

Some people may tolerate small amounts of lactose. A gradual reintroduction of lactose-containing foods can help determine individual tolerance levels. This approach should be done under the guidance of a healthcare professional or dietitian.

Pharmacological Interventions

1. Lactase Supplements

Lactase enzyme supplements are available over-the-counter and can be taken before consuming lactose-containing foods. These supplements help break down lactose, potentially alleviating symptoms. They are particularly useful for individuals who wish to enjoy dairy products without discomfort.

2. Probiotics

Some studies suggest that probiotics may help improve lactose digestion by enhancing gut health. Probiotics can be found in fermented foods or as dietary supplements. However, the effectiveness can vary among individuals, and more research is needed to establish definitive benefits.

Education and Support

1. Nutritional Counseling

Consulting with a registered dietitian can provide personalized dietary advice and help ensure that individuals with lactose intolerance maintain a balanced diet. This is crucial to avoid nutritional deficiencies, particularly in calcium and vitamin D, which are abundant in dairy products.

2. Support Groups

Joining support groups or online communities can provide emotional support and practical tips for managing lactose intolerance. Sharing experiences with others facing similar challenges can be beneficial.
